**Lift Maintenance — Weekends at Fennick Court**

Heads up: the lifts get serviced most Saturdays between 7:00 and 13:00, so plan any weekend deliveries for the afternoon. During the works, use the goods stairs by the post room — they're quicker than they look. The stairwell door is kept locked at weekends, so grab the access code first.

staff pass of kawip-hawef = bdg-QLP-2

## Break-Glass Access: Gatekite Rate Limiter

Welcome aboard. The Gatekite gateway enforces per-tenant rate limits on all internal APIs. If a limit misconfiguration blocks critical traffic, break-glass access lets you bypass the limiter for one hour. Use it only after paging the platform lead, and document every action in the incident log. To unlock the override console, enter the recovery passphrase exactly as shown below.

strongbox words: sorir-belvan-rusix-ulays-ralmir-praix-eliir-tamax-praael-druael-julir-tamius-jorir

### Payments sync — test stability

Discussed ongoing flakiness in Ledgerpoint integration tests. Roughly 12% of CI runs fail on the settlement-retry suite, usually due to a race between the mock clearinghouse and the webhook listener. Agreed to quarantine the three worst offenders and add deterministic clocks rather than sleeps. Release manager asked that no payments release ship until flake rate drops below 2%. A single owner was assigned to drive the fix and report daily; their name follows.

approver of yajef-fajef = Oliwyn Silion Kasok Kasox

## Migration Step 4: Resolving Calendar Sync Conflicts

When migrating Tidewell Scheduler tenants to the new sync engine, duplicate events may appear if both the legacy and new engines wrote during the cutover window. Run the `dedupe_events` script, which compares `source_uid` and `last_modified` fields and keeps the newer record. Review the conflict report it produces before committing; never skip this step, as silent merges can drop attendee lists. The script must be pointed at the tenant's primary database using the connection string below.

primary connection of tajeg-tajop = postgresql://julax_svc:DI@db-e7f3.kelvidyn.corp:5432/rusdor